EVO X Testpipe fits BOTH RA and X. The difference you see above is a design choice. The OEM cat (on both cars) have a bend to it. As a result the Rexspeed follows the same bend. I know of other manufacturers that do the same - CP-E, and I think Speed Circuit. The ones that are straight test pipes (like UR and AMS) use angled flanges to get the same fitment.
I hope this clarifies everything.

What you are confused about is the O2 Housing (sometimes known as Long) Downpipe. The ones that are the same are the Short Downpipes which is O2 housing back. The Long downpipe saves u the trouble of buying the O2 housing when doing the X-swap as the O2 housing is different in both cars.
